American Water Named One of the 100 Most Sustainable Companies
VOORHEES, N.J.–(BUSINESS WIRE)–American Water Works Company, Inc. (NYSE: AWK), the largest publicly
traded U.S. water and wastewater utility company, announced today it was
named as one of the 100
Most Sustainable Companies by Barron’s Magazine.

Last year, American Water published its biennial corporate
responsibility report that highlighted the value the company places
on being a good corporate citizen. Some of the key accomplishments in
the report include the following:
-
American Water has invested more than $2 billion in capital
infrastructure in 2015 and 2016 to build a more resilient system for
our customers. -
American Water has realized more than $19.6 million in savings through
249 process excellence initiatives in 2015 and 2016. -
American Water has partnered with local environmental groups on 89
stewardship projects in 11 states. These projects were awarded funding
for initiatives related to clean water, conservation, education, and
community sustainability. -
American Water’s annual AmerICANs in Action! Month of Service,
established in 2011 to foster community service among employees and
encourage them to volunteer in communities, continued to grow. In
2016, a record-breaking 2,266 American Water employees participated in
116 different projects, contributing more than 4,000 volunteer hours.

About American Water
With a history dating back to 1886, American Water is the largest and
most geographically diverse U.S. publicly-traded water and wastewater
utility company. The company employs more than 6,800 dedicated
professionals who provide regulated and market-based drinking water,
wastewater and other related services to an estimated 15 million people
in 47 states and Ontario, Canada. More information can be found by
